Print Maren 16 is a regular weight, normal width, low contrast, upright, normal x-height font.

A rounded, monoline handwritten print with gently uneven stroke edges and soft, blunted terminals. Letterforms are upright with a lively, slightly bouncy baseline and mild inconsistencies in width and curvature that enhance the drawn-by-hand feel. Counters are open and simple, with minimal detail and low modulation, and many shapes lean toward chunky, softly squared curves rather than sharp corners. Overall spacing feels generous and informal, prioritizing an easy, approachable rhythm over strict geometric regularity.
Well-suited for short-to-medium text in friendly contexts such as packaging, invitations, greeting cards, classroom materials, and social posts. It can also work for headers, pull quotes, and playful branding where a human, handcrafted voice is desirable, especially at sizes where the rounded details and lively rhythm remain clear.
The font reads as cheerful and approachable, with a kid-friendly, doodled character that feels personal and unpretentious. Its soft curves and subtly quirky proportions give it a lighthearted tone suited to warm, conversational messaging rather than formal or corporate voice.
The design appears intended to emulate neat, informal hand lettering with dependable readability, combining simple printed shapes with small natural variations to feel authentic and personable. It aims for charm and warmth without relying on heavy texture or high contrast.
Capitals are bold and simple with a sign-painter-like steadiness, while lowercase keeps a casual, note-taking energy; together they create a cohesive, friendly texture in paragraphs. Numerals match the same rounded, hand-drawn construction, maintaining consistency for mixed text settings.
